DNA

A while ago I was given some information that a cousin from the Elia family had done one of those Genealogy DNA tests and had a hit. I was given the name and it was someone from the Rizk family.

With a Rizk match I was a little bit excited as the Khoury family was originally Rizk and I like to always increase the family and get to know more cousins.

Well I didn't really do a lot of digging as I didn't have much information so I let it go. But a couple of days ago a cousin asked if I had ever done a DNA test which got me thinking about it again. So went back to the original message I received and decided to start doing some internet searches using the email address I had. I got a couple of hits on Google giving me a location.

I was able to find a Facebook profile and found even though the person was living in Australia they are originally from the US and the name was spelt Rask not Rizk. I searched Ancestry.com and came up with some online family trees that showed the family was from Hadchit in North Lebanon. This to me is quite interesting as when I was in Lebanon in 2010 my uncle told me that we are also related to the Rizk family in the Bsharre are....Hadchit is not far from Bsharre.

Now where this gets interesting is that going back to the story of Boulos Rizk the founder of our village his family fled from Forzol after killing the local Governor. I was told the family came to the south but there is no reason why they couldn't have crossed the mountains to the Hadchit area.

I'm hoping this opens up to a new branch in the family and I get a reply to the email that I sent.
